
PRML学习笔记:机器学习与模式识别精华

"PRML笔记,涵盖模式识别与机器学习的核心概念"
PRML(模式识别与机器学习)笔记是由Bishop编写的经典教材《Pattern Recognition and Machine Learning》的学习笔记,这是一本非常适合初学者的资源。笔记内容详尽,涵盖了从基础的概率分布到高级的机器学习算法,对于刚入门或尚未入门的人来说具有极大的帮助。
1. **概率分布** (Chapter 2): 这一章介绍了概率论的基础,包括联合分布、边缘分布和条件分布,以及概率密度函数和累积分布函数。这些是理解统计推断和机器学习算法的基础,如贝叶斯定理。
2. **线性回归模型** (Chapter 3): 讲解了线性回归的基本原理,包括最小二乘法和正规方程,以及闭式解的求解方法。这对于预测建模是非常重要的。
3. **线性分类模型** (Chapter 4): 本章深入讨论了逻辑回归(Logistic Regression)及其在分类问题中的应用,包括牛顿迭代法(IRLS)和贝叶斯逻辑回归(Bayesian Logistic Regression),后者使用拉普拉斯近似。
4. **神经网络** (Chapter 5): 神经网络是深度学习的基础,这里讲解了神经网络的结构和反向传播算法,以及用于回归和分类的贝叶斯神经网络,其后处理使用了拉普拉斯近似。
5. **核方法** (Chapter 6): 介绍了支持向量机(SVM)的理论,它是非线性分类和回归的强大工具,通过核技巧可以将低维空间的数据映射到高维空间进行线性处理。
6. **稀疏核机器** (Chapter 7): 讨论了如何在大量特征下有效地应用核方法,以减少计算复杂度并保持模型性能。
7. **图模型** (Chapter 8): 介绍了马尔可夫随机场和贝叶斯网络,它们在建模变量间依赖关系和推理上有广泛应用。
8. **混合模型与EM算法** (Chapter 9): 混合模型,如高斯混合模型(GMM),用于建模复杂数据分布,而EM(期望最大化)算法用于参数估计。
9. **近似推理** (Chapter 10): 探讨了在复杂模型中进行有效推理的近似方法,如变分推理和蒙特卡洛方法。
10. **采样方法** (Chapter 11): 介绍了马尔可夫链蒙特卡洛(MCMC)等重要采样技术,这些方法在处理连续隐藏变量时非常有用。
11. **连续潜变量** (Chapter 12): 讨论了如何在模型中处理连续的不可观测变量,这对于隐马尔可夫模型(HMM)和动态贝叶斯网络(DBN)等序列模型至关重要。
12. **序列数据** (Chapter 13): 针对时间序列分析和序列建模,如自回归移动平均模型(ARMA)和状态空间模型。
13. **模型组合** (Chapter 14): 介绍了如何结合多个模型以提高预测性能,如集成学习(Ensemble Learning)和堆叠泛化(Stacking)。
这个笔记不仅提供了理论基础,还包含了实际应用案例和算法实现的细节,是学习和理解模式识别与机器学习领域的重要参考资料。通过阅读和实践,读者可以逐步建立起对这个领域的深入理解。
相关推荐
















beyond6987
- 粉丝: 3
最新资源
- 实现 Ember Pod 结构中顶级共享文件夹的访问方法
- 贝岭开源MATLAB代码项目:belle-baby
- Go语言包Whatever使用教程:处理Params与map[string]interface{}
- 贝岭开发的Kotlin图片浏览应用与Matlab代码集成
- Sails.js社交认证示例:构建支持在线内容的likebucket应用
- 深入探究Docker镜像构建:silvia的Python与nginx环境
- 在Alpine Linux上构建Docker最小Ruby容器指南
- 使用phusion/baseimage-docker构建Docker化的PHP&Nginx环境
- Node.js性能对比:C++与JavaScript模块速度测试
- 微信小程序后端解密手机号码教程(JSP/Java版)
- Matlab数据分析与代码混淆工具
- 掌握socket.io事件:CLI工具的使用与介绍
- Raspberry Pi上通过Docker构建Busybox环境
- Random-Coords:Python工具生成美国随机地理坐标
- 创建PHP CLI Docker镜像的快捷方法
- 罗斯福高中IronRiders团队开源FRC机器人竞赛代码
- 深入探索jseabold.github.com:我的个人主页技术解析
- WarpDrive:企业级JavaScript曲速驱动管理软件
- Coursera 数据整理课程项目 - 从智能手机数据集生成整洁数据集
- 全面掌握Python爬虫技术:从基础到高阶案例解析
- WSN网络数据包追踪与路径恢复的MATLAB仿真技术
- kargo:Web浏览器中通过Docker访问终端模拟器
- Node.js中的Passport-Linkedin-Token-OAuth2身份验证插件
- Python编程实例库:分享与学习